disassembled
英 [ˌdɪsəˈsembld]
美 [ˌdɪsəˈsembld]
v. 拆卸; 拆开; 反汇编(将计算机编码译成普通语言); 散开; 分散
disassemble的过去分词和过去式
过去式:disassembled

柯林斯词典
- VERB 拆卸;拆开
Todisassemblesomething means to take it to pieces.- You'll have to disassemble the drill.
你得拆开这个钻头。
